Getting Geared Up For Smoothie Life with Green Blender

Can you believe how fast 2017 is going?! Maybe it’s just me because so many things are happening at once but, I already find myself preparing for our annual Green Smoothie Challenge. For those of you who are new to this, for one month we try to dedicate ourselves to incorporating one green smoothie into our day either as a meal replacement or as a snack. This way we get in the habit of incorporating more leafy greens into our diet and learn how beneficial adding more fruits and veggies into our diet can be for our mind, body, and soul.
